Based loosely on the novel by Yves Viollier, Les Sœurs Robin follows , two elderly, single, and childless sisters who live together in the decaying countryside home built by their grandfather.

Les Sœurs Robin (also known internationally as The Robin Sisters ) is a French television film that first aired in Belgium on , before reaching French audiences on February 17, 2007 . Produced by AT-Production and France 3, the film runs for 105 minutes and falls squarely within the drama genre, though its tone carries elements of warmth, melancholy, and even subtle comedy. It was directed by Jacques Renard , a filmmaker known for his sensitivity to regional French life and literature, and adapted from the popular novel of the same name by Yves Viollier .
